     33The above figure shows the wired topology. STA 1 and the AP are suppressed by 50 dB of external attenuation (plus cable loss and 3 dB loss through the power splitter). The same is true for the link between STA 2 and the AP. The link between STA 1 and STA 2, however, involves 100 dB of external attenuation as well as the tens of dB attenuation after leakage between the two input ports of the power splitter. This attenuation is sufficiently large such that neither STA can decode the other's transmissions. Furthermore, it is sufficient attenuation such that neither STA can physically carrier sense each other's transmissions.

     45In this experiment, we will break up a single trial into three sequential pieces. In the first 30 second phase, we will start Flow 1 all by itself. In the second 30 second phase, we will disable Flow 1 and start Flow 2 by itself. In the third and final 30 second phase, we will enable both Flows 1 and 2. This entire experiment will be performed for both an RTS/CTS disabled case as well as an RTS/CTS enabled case.
